Wix MCP Server
Wix now provides a Model Context Protocol (MCP) server that allows you to work with Wix tools and services in your chosen AI client. By configuring the Wix MCP server, you enable your client to search the Wix documentation, write code for the Wix platform, and make API calls on Wix sites. This saves you the time and effort of finding and applying the information in the documentation yourself.

This section shows you the basic configuration you need to add to your AI tool to use the Wix MCP server.
To add the Wix MCP server to your agent, include the following JSON object in your MCP server configuration:
{ "mcpServers": { "wix-mcp-remote": { "command": "npx", "args": [ "-y", "@wix/mcp-remote", "https://mcp.wix.com/sse" ] } } }

The Wix MCP server provides the following tools in the table below. All of these tools are enabled by default.
Tool | Description |
SearchWixWDSDocumentation | Search the Wix Design System documentation. |
SearchWixRESTDocumentation | Search the Wix REST documentation. |
SearchWixSDKDocumentation | Search the Wix SDK documentation. |
SearchBuildAppsDocumentation | Search the Wix Build Apps documentation. |
SearchWixHeadlessDocumentation | Search the Wix Headless documentation. |
WixBusinessFlowsDocumentation | Include complete step-by-step instructions for multi-step sample flows. |
ReadFullDocsArticle | Fetch the full content of an article by article URL. |
ReadFullDocsMethodSchema | Get the full request and response schema of an API method. |
ListWixSites | Query the sites for a Wix account. |
CallWixSiteAPI | Perform an action or query for a given account and selected site. |
ManageWixSite | Perform a site-level action, such as creating a site. |
SupportAndFeedback | Prompt the user for feedback and send it to Wix. |
If you’re getting errors when running the MCP server, try the following:
Check the IDE logs.
Check if the error is related to your package manager. Make sure you have the latest node version as the default on the path.
Check that you entered the npx arguments correctly in the configuration. Make sure you included -y
and the correct npm registry.
Include the full path to Node.
Restart the IDE.
Run the MCP server directly on the command line:
npx -y @wix/mcp-remote https://mcp.wix.com/sse
The connection to the server may be lost after a long period of inactivity, or if you switch the Wix account you’re authenticating with. In that case, it may help to delete ~/.mcp-auth
(on Mac) or C:\Users\\.mcp-auth
(on Windows).
